Why Should I Choose a Local Auto Body Shop?

August 12, 2026

Choosing where to take your vehicle after an accident or when repairs are needed is an important decision that can impact both the condition of your car and your overall experience. With so many options available, many drivers find themselves weighing convenience against quality and trust. This is where working with a local auto body shop becomes a meaningful choice. Local providers often offer a level of attention, accountability, and community connection that can be difficult to find elsewhere, making them a preferred option for many vehicle owners.



Trust plays a significant role in any automotive service decision. Drivers want to feel confident that their vehicle is in capable hands and that recommended repairs are necessary and performed correctly. A local auto body shop typically relies on its reputation within the community, which encourages a strong focus on transparency and customer satisfaction. This connection helps build lasting relationships and creates a more personalized experience for each customer.


According to Consumer Affairs, survey findings indicate that about 78% of car owners do not always trust their mechanics, underscoring how important it is to find a provider that prioritizes honesty and clear communication. This statistic highlights why many drivers turn to businesses they can get to know and rely on over time. Establishing that trust is often easier when working with a local provider that values long-term relationships.

Building Strong Customer Relationships


Providing Personalized Service

One of the most noticeable benefits of working with a local provider is the level of personalized attention. A local auto body shop often takes the time to understand each customer’s specific needs, ensuring that repairs are tailored to both the vehicle and the owner’s expectations. This approach creates a more comfortable and collaborative experience.


Encouraging Open Communication

Clear and consistent communication is essential when dealing with vehicle repairs. Local businesses are more likely to provide direct updates, answer questions thoroughly, and explain repair processes in a way that is easy to understand. This transparency helps reduce uncertainty and builds confidence.


Supporting Long-Term Relationships

Unlike larger, more impersonal service centers, local shops often aim to build long-term relationships with their customers. This ongoing connection encourages repeat visits and fosters trust over time, making it easier for drivers to return when future needs arise.


Creating a Community Connection

Local businesses are part of the communities they serve. This connection often leads to a greater sense of accountability and pride in the work performed, which directly benefits customers.


Ensuring High-Quality Workmanship


Focusing on Detailed Repairs

Quality is a top priority for many local providers. A local auto body shop often emphasizes attention to detail, ensuring that repairs are completed to a high standard. This focus helps restore vehicles to their original condition while maintaining safety and performance.


Using Skilled Technicians

Experienced technicians play a critical role in delivering reliable results. Local shops often employ professionals who are highly trained and familiar with a wide range of repair techniques, contributing to consistent outcomes.


Maintaining Consistent Standards

Reputation is everything for local businesses. Maintaining high standards is essential for earning positive reviews and referrals, which encourages a commitment to excellence in every repair.


Delivering Reliable Results

Consistency is key when it comes to vehicle repairs. Drivers can expect dependable service and lasting results when working with a provider that values craftsmanship and precision.
